Specifications:
The MA5616 provides ADSL2+, VDSL2, SHDSL, POTS, FE, P2P, ISDN, and combo broadband user ports,
and it supports dual upstream transmission channels through auto-adaptive GPON and GE ports. The
MA5616 can be installed indoor and outdoor in a range of locations, such as in corridors and cabinets, and
can be used in fiber to the curb (FTTC), fiber to the building (FTTB), mini-DSLAM, and mini-MSAN scenarios.
The SmartAX MA5616 multi-service access module (the MA5616 for short) provides access services with ultra-high bandwidths and flexible capacity expansion capabilities. TheMA5616 applies to fiber to the building
(FTTB), fiber to the curb (FTTC), fiber to the node(FTTN), and private line access scenarios.
Dimensions of the MA5616
Type | Width x Depth x Height |
MA5616 (without the mounting brackets) | 442 mm x 245 mm x 88.1 mm |
MA5616 (with mounting brackets for 19-inchdevices) | 482.6 mm x 245 mm x88.1 mm |
Weight
Configuration | Weight |
Empty chassis | ≤4.8 kg |
Full configuration (xDSL+POTS) | ≤7.3 kg |
Full configuration (FE+POTS) NOTE Only the CCUC control board supports this configuration. | ≤7.3 kg |
Environment parameters
Environment Parameter | Value |
Working environment temperature | -40°C to +65°C The device can start up at -25°C and run at-40°C. |
Working environment humidity | 5% RH to 95% RH Atmospheric pressure 70 kPa to 106 kPa |
Altitude | ≤ 4000 m NOTE The highest temperature at an altitude below 1800 m is 65°C. The highest ambient temperature degrades by 1°C each time the elevation increases by 220 m within the range of 1800 m to 4000 m. |
GPON Features
As the wide use of broadband services and fiber-in and copper-out development, carriers requirea longer transmission reach, higher bandwidth, reliability, and lower operating
expense (OPEX)on services. Gigabit passive optical network (GPON) resolves the problem by providing:
l A longer transmission reach: The optical fiber is used in transmission and the coverage radius of the access layer is 20 km.
l A higher bandwidth: The maximum downstream bandwidth is 2.5 Gbit/s and the maximum upstream bandwidth is 1.25 Gbit/s for each subscriber.
l Quality of service (QoS) guaranteed for all services: The GPON can carry GPON encapsulation mode (GEM) frames, ensuring better QoS.
l Optical split feature: Multiple optical fibers are routed to users after optical splitting from a single optical fiber in the central office (CO). This feature saves optical fiber resources, reduces the number of optical and electrical devices in the CO, and reduces the OPEX.
Reference Standards and Protocols
l ITU-T G.984.1: General Characteristics.
l TU-T G.984.2: Physical Media Dependent (PMD) Layer Specification.
l ITU-T G.984.3: Transmission Convergence Layer Specification.
l ITU-T G.984.4: ONT Management And Control Interface Specification.
l ITU-T G.984.5: Enhancement Band.
l ITU-T G.984.6: Reach Extension.
